The message echoes one of the most powerful scenes in the New Testament. Peter steps out of the boat, eyes fixed on Jesus, walking on water with a faith that defies logic. But the moment he looks at the wind and the waves, he begins to sink. Jesus reaches out, lifts him, and reminds him where his strength comes from. “Take courage… do not be afraid.” (Matthew 14:27)
